What are some common challenges faced by a Channel Manager, and how can they be overcome?

Channel Managers often encounter the challenge of maintaining strong relationships with multiple partners while ensuring that sales targets and brand standards are met. Balancing partner needs with company objectives can require excellent communication and negotiation skills. To overcome these challenges, successful Channel Managers regularly engage with partners through clear updates, joint planning sessions, and by providing ongoing support and training. Building trust and being proactive in resolving conflicts or bottlenecks are also key to thriving in this dynamic role.
